Why Most Garment Search Requests Suffer from Lack of Detail

Most online garment requests fail because seekers submit single, blurry photos taken under dim lighting without contextual detail. An algorithm or human archivist cannot distinguish a 1970s rayon aloha shirt from a 1990s polyester reproduction based on a front-facing silhouette shot alone.

Archival Memory Density refers to the depth of structural detail provided in a query, which directly dictates whether community sleuths can cross-reference physical production catalogs. Higher detail density eliminates speculation and enables precise pattern matching.

Signs Your Sourcing Query Lacks Diagnostic Value

A search request typically stalls when it relies solely on vague descriptive adjectives like 'colorful' or 'retro statement shirt.' Requests missing tag close-ups, button composition notes, or fabric drape details force archivists to make blind guesses.

Without specific Garment Provenance Anchors, online sleuths cannot cross-reference print archives or factory hem techniques. A query without macro hardware photos yields conflicting community speculation rather than concrete catalog matches.

What to Actually Provide in a Garment Search Request

Pattern Repeats and Graphic Geometry

Hardware and Structural Seams

Geographic Sourcing and Fabric Texture

Pattern Repeats and Graphic Geometry: Upload clear, uncropped photos of the print repeat, paying special attention to chest pocket alignment. Matched pattern pockets indicate higher-end construction techniques often tied to specific historical apparel makers.

Hardware and Structural Seams: Photograph collar construction, button material (such as carved coconut, mother-of-pearl, or urea resin), and interior side seams. Serged seams, French seams, and single-needle tailoring serve as chronological benchmarks for fashion historians.

Geographic Sourcing and Fabric Texture: State where and when the garment was originally acquired, alongside tactile descriptions of the weave. Rayon drape, slubbed silk texture, and heavy-gauge combed cotton each point to distinct manufacturing hubs and production eras.

What People Get Wrong About Crowdsourced Fashion Sleuthing

The common assumption that automated reverse image search tools will identify any lost shirt ignores how regional resort wear prints were manufactured. Many artistic menswear pieces were produced in limited short runs without digital catalog backups.

Automated visual recognition fails on complex textile prints lacking web indexing. Successful identification relies on human archival knowledge and physical construction analysis rather than visual matching algorithms.

What Most People Try First (And Why the Results Plateau)

Garment seekers usually follow a predictable sequence before reaching out to specialized communities:

1. Running a general visual search query — yields hundreds of generic modern Hawaiian shirts, but misses the specific vintage pattern motif. 2. Posting a single wide-angle photo to social platforms — generates vague guesses based on surface color rather than concrete manufacturing markers. 3. Searching resale platforms with broad keywords — leads to endless scrolling through thousands of unrelated camp collar shirts due to missing structural criteria.

Each approach plateaus because surface graphics alone cannot isolate regional textile production runs without hardware and seam metadata.

Understanding Garment Provenance Anchors in Sourcing

Garment Provenance Anchors refers to specific structural and visual markers — such as matched chest pocket prints, coconut shell buttons, and French seams — used to establish a garment's manufacturing origin. Without these structural indicators, a lost statement shirt reads as a generic mass-market print. With clear macro documentation of seam finishing and hardware, online archivists can trace the design to specific regional textile mills and production runs.

Evaluating Print Repeat and Pocket Alignment Architecture

In high-tier resort shirts and wearable art garments, pattern matching across the front placket and chest pocket requires significant fabric yield and precise cutting. Documenting whether a lost shirt features a continuous print repeat across the pocket helps archivists immediately filter out lower-cost mass production, isolating boutique makers who prioritized pattern continuity.

Frequently Asked Questions

What is Archival Memory Density in garment identification?

Archival Memory Density refers to the depth of physical and contextual detail provided in a search query. High density includes macro photos of seams, buttons, tags, and purchase geography, allowing community archivists to cross-reference catalog records accurately.

Why does seam construction matter when searching for a lost shirt?

Seam construction reveals the manufacturing era and quality tier of a garment. Single-needle stitching, serged seams, and French seams serve as precise historical benchmarks for fashion sleuths tracing unlabelled items.

How do you identify an unlabelled vintage Hawaiian shirt?

Identify unlabelled vintage Hawaiian shirts by examining button materials, pattern repeat alignment, collar stay structure, and fabric drape. Comparing these physical traits against documented maker profiles allows vintage collectors to identify the manufacturer without a brand tag.

What visual details help reverse image search find rare statement shirts?

Upload flat, well-lit photos of distinct graphic motifs and clean pattern repeats rather than full-body worn shots. Isolating unique artistic elements prevents search algorithms from matching generic shirt silhouettes.
